| TypeBot is a chatbot builder tool. Prior to version 3.16.0, the OpenAI "Create Transcription" action handler fetches a user-supplied audio URL using `fetch()` without applying the SSRF protection that exists elsewhere in the codebase. An attacker can direct the server to make HTTP requests to arbitrary internal addresses and localhost. The fetched content is passed to the OpenAI Whisper API and the transcription result is returned to the attacker. Version 3.16.0 fixes the issue. | ||||

| Rekor is a software supply chain transparency log. Starting in version 0.3.0 and prior to version 1.5.2, the `Package.Unmarshal()` function in `pkg/types/alpine/apk.go` decompresses the signature and control gzip members of an APK file into in-memory buffers without bounding the total decompressed size. The existing `max_apk_metadata_size` check (default 1MB) is only applied to individual tar entry header sizes after decompression completes, so it does not prevent a decompression bomb from consuming unbounded heap memory. An attacker can craft a gzip stream that compresses at a ~1000:1 ratio (e.g., 2MB compressed zeros → 2GB decompressed). When submitted as spec.package.content in an Alpine `ProposedEntry`, the server decompresses the full payload into memory during request processing, triggering a fatal Go runtime out-of-memory error or OS OOM-kill that cannot be caught by the server's recover() middleware. This is reachable via two unauthenticated endpoints, `POST /api/v1/log/entries (createLogEntry)` and `POST /api/v1/log/entries/retrieve (searchLogQuery)`. Both invoke `V001Entry.Canonicalize()` → `fetchExternalEntities()` → `apk.Unmarshal(packageData)`, which performs the unbounded decompression. Version 1.5.2 patches the issue. There is no effective workaround. Setting `max_request_body_size` reduces but does not eliminate exposure due to the ~1000:1 compression ratio (a 1MB body limit still allows ~1GB heap allocation). Setting `max_apk_metadata_size` has no effect on this vulnerability since the check is applied after decompression. | ||||

| Streambert is a cross-platform Electron Desktop App to stream and download video content. Versions prior to 2.5.0 contain an unvalidated auto-updater URL vulnerability that allows a compromised renderer process to make the main process download and execute an arbitrary binary, resulting in remote code execution. Version 2.5.0 contains a patch. | ||||

| Admidio is an open-source user management solution. Prior to version 5.0.10, `modules/sso/clients.php` validates an `adm_csrf_token` on every state-changing branch except `enable`. The `enable` case loads the SAML or OIDC client by UUID, calls `$client->enable($enabled)`, and persists the new state with no token check. Because the action is reachable via plain GET parameters, a third-party page can trick an authenticated administrator into disabling (or silently re-enabling) any configured SAML or OIDC client. Disabling an SSO client breaks every downstream relying-party application that authenticates through it. Version 5.0.10 contains a fix. | ||||

| cJSON versions 1.5.0 through 1.7.19 contain an incorrectly-resolved name or reference vulnerability in the decode_pointer_inplace() function within cJSON_Utils.c that allows unauthenticated attackers to cause JSON Patch operations to target wrong object keys by supplying crafted JSON Pointer escape sequences (~0 or ~1) in patch paths. Attackers can submit malicious RFC 6902 JSON Patch input to applications using cJSONUtils_ApplyPatches() or cJSONUtils_ApplyPatchesCaseSensitive() to silently corrupt data or delete unintended keys, potentially bypassing authorization controls in applications that rely on JSON Patch for access-controlled data modification. | ||||
